Double doors with glass handles aren't easy to install however if you're willing to put in the effort and are armed with a bit of knowledge, it's not difficult. It is crucial to choose the right replacement handle, and note the PZ and whether it's spring-loaded or not.

There are many varieties of uPVC handles that are available and some are better suited for specific doors than others. Some are primarily designed for aesthetic reasons while others are more security-focused. For instance, certain uPVC handles are constructed of tougher materials such as stainless steel that can provide more strength and security. However, others are made from plastics like ABS and uPVC that are less susceptible to be damaged in the event of a knock or bump.
It is essential to consider the screw center measurement and the PZ dimension when choosing the handle to replace and also the length of the backplate. This will ensure that the new uPVC handle is properly fitted and works seamlessly with the door's lock mechanism.
The most popular uPVC handle is the lever/lever model that includes two levers inline on either side. They are connected to the door using spindles that are used to open and close the door. If your double-glazed door is difficult to open or the handle is falling down and sagging, it's not a damaged handle. Instead the worn-out springs within the lock case could be the cause. A professional locksmith will be able to examine the issue and repair door handle suggest a solution.
uPVC handle replacements are available from a range of manufacturers including Yale Avocet/WMS Fullex, Hoppe and Roto and many more. They are available in a variety of colors and finishes to fit your decor. Some are powder coated and others have PVD (Physical Vapour Deposition) finish that is a premium durable, long-lasting and low-maintenance coating.

Lever pad door handles are a great option for those looking to improve the appearance of their door. They are designed for split spindle locks and have a lever either side of the door. Each lever operates on its own by using offset spindles. This design is more comfortable and prevents the latch being withdrawn from the outside. Only a key will open the door if it's not deadlocked.

It is important to measure three things prior to buying a new door handle to ensure that the new handles fit correctly. The first measurement to consider is the PZ. This measures the distance between the screw fixing points on backplate of the door handle. The thickness of the handle is the second measurement. The third measurement is the measurement of the center hole for the multipoint locks that will be put on the door.
The Heritage Inline Sprung Pad Door Handle is a popular choice for those looking to replace their current handles. The handle is designed for the Euro Cylinder multi-point lock and has a PZ centre of 92mm. The handle comes with a variety of Type A or B backplates that can be used to accommodate different door thicknesses.
